[0001] This utility model relates to the field of optical instrument technology, and in particular to a rapid positioning and clamping device for glass plates. Background Technology

[0002] Large-aperture optical transmission instruments are large-scale scientific experimental facilities that are technically challenging, involve multiple disciplines, and have a high degree of engineering integration. Glass slides are commonly used as the isolation medium in large-aperture optical transmission instruments, serving both to transmit light and isolate the atmospheric environment from the experimental environment. With the continuous development of optical technology, researchers have placed higher demands on the positioning and clamping devices for glass slides, requiring them to be able to be installed quickly and stably and to facilitate subsequent maintenance and replacement.

[0003] Currently, glass slides are mainly fixed by clamping. During installation, the glass slide needs to be adjusted into place before the clamping plate is installed. When replacing the glass slide, the clamping screws need to be loosened and the clamping plate removed. The maintenance time is relatively long, which increases the risk of contamination of the experimental environment and is not conducive to controlling the cleanliness of the experimental environment. [0020] like Figure 1-4 As shown, a quick-positioning and clamping device for a glass sheet includes a glass sheet 1, a mounting frame 6, a quick-release unit for the glass sheet, and a locking mechanism. The mounting frame 6 is U-shaped, with an inwardly recessed mounting groove. The quick-release unit for the glass sheet includes a frame 2, which is U-shaped and has a glass slot. The glass sheet 1 is inserted into the glass slot, and the frame 2 is inserted into the mounting groove. A positioning locking block 201 is fixedly installed at one end of the frame 2, and the positioning locking block 201 has a 45-degree chamfer. The mounting frame 6 has a locking hole 202 facing the positioning locking block 201. The locking mechanism is mounted on the mounting frame 6 and can lock the positioning locking block 201 inserted into the locking hole.

[0021] During implementation, a rubber pad 7 is fixedly installed in the glass slot of the frame 2.

[0022] The quick-release glass plate unit includes a frame 2, which is assembled with the glass plate 1 and rubber pads 7. This unit, serving as the smallest unit for subsequent maintenance of the glass plate, possesses good rigidity and positioning capability, enabling rapid and non-destructive replacement of the glass plate. The frame 2 integrates a positioning lock 201 and three rubber pads 7, evenly spaced on the side of the frame 2. Before replacing the glass plate 1, it is necessary to install the glass plate 1 onto the frame 2 and assemble the quick-release glass plate unit. The positioning lock 201 has a 45-degree chamfer, providing guidance and lateral pushing functions during the installation of the frame 2.

[0023] In implementation, the locking mechanism includes a pressure cap 3, a spring 5, and a spring pin 4. The pressure cap 3 is fixedly mounted on the mounting bracket 6. The spring pin 4 includes a button end, a locking end, and a spring fixing end. The locking end of the spring pin 4 has a 60-degree chamfer. The mounting bracket 6 has a positioning mounting hole opposite the button end of the spring pin 4. The button end extends outward through the positioning mounting hole. The mounting bracket 6 also has a spring mounting hole. The pressure cap 3 has a clearance blind hole opposite the spring mounting hole. The spring fixing end passes through the spring mounting hole and extends into the clearance blind hole. The spring 5 is sleeved on the outside of the spring fixing end. One end of the spring 5 is located in the clearance blind hole, and the other end of the spring 5 abuts against the button end. The positioning locking block 201 is positioned opposite the locking end.

[0024] The 60-degree chamfered surface of the spring pin 5 interacts with the 45-degree chamfered surface of the locking block 201 when the glass quick-release unit is installed, forming an automatic clearance function.

[0025] After installing the quick-release glass plate unit, the quick-release glass plate unit can be directly pushed into the mounting slot on the mounting bracket 6. The positioning locking block 201 on the frame 1 cooperates with the locking end, pushing the locking end to move, thereby compressing the spring 4. The spring pin 5 will move towards the back of the mounting bracket 6. After the frame 2 is pushed to the set position, the spring 4 returns to its original position, thereby driving the spring pin 5 to lock the frame 2, preventing the frame 2 from being displaced by external influences.

[0026] When disassembling the quick-release unit of the glass plate, the button end of the spring pin 5 needs to be pressed on the front of the mounting bracket 6, so that the spring pin 5 is pressed towards the back of the mounting bracket 6. At this time, the frame locking device is unlocked, and the frame 2 can be smoothly pulled out of the mounting bracket 6 to realize the quick-release action of the glass plate.
